Maak.el — Lisp machine command runner in Emacs, infinitely extensible and Scheme

Summary

Maak.el is an Emacs integration for Maak, the Lisp-based command runner. It enables discovering, listing, and executing Maak tasks directly from Emacs, with interactive parameter prompts and asynchronous execution, leveraging Guile Scheme; the project is open-source and hosted on Codeberg, with installation and usage details in the README.
